Summer 2004 -- Competed for South Korea in the 2004 Athens Olympics.
2004 -- Broke his own Korean National pole vault record with a jump of 18-04.50 at the NCAA Championships to finish second overall, earning All-American honors ... Regional Championships (17-7) and Pac-10 (17-07.25) runner-up ... Won the USC/UCLA Dual Meet ... Finished second at the Texas Relays (18-00.50).
2003 -- Set the Korean National pole vault record of 18-2.50, placing second at the Pac-10 Championships ... Earned All-America honors at the NCAA Championships, placing fifth (tied) with a vault of 17-4.50 ... Placed second at the NCAA West Regional (17-11).
2002 -- Redshirted the 2002 season.
2001 -- Outstanding season as a true freshman ... Kim qualified for the NCAA Outdoor (then personal-best 17-4.25) and placed 11th (tying his personal-best) ... At the Pac-10 meet, Kim finished fifth (16-11).
High School-- Three-year NEPSTA pole vault champion...Holds the NEPSTA record at 14-7...Member of the Korean World Junior Championship team (October 2000)...Prep best was 16-8.
Personal-- Born January 19, 1982 ... Sociology major.
